Farmers from the Netherlands, France, and other European colonies that settled in South Africa became known as

Geography
1 answer:
Bas_tet [7]3 years ago
4 0
<span>Farmers from the Netherlands, France, and other European colonies that settled in South Africa became known as Boers.

How is Geography divided up due to it's being such a broad topic?
dimulka [17.4K]

Answer:

Geography is divided into two main categories known as Physical and Human geography

Explanation:

Geography involves the study of the different features and phenomenon which occurs on the earth and other planets.

It is divided into two broad categories known as :

1. Physical Geography which involves the study of the physical features of the earth environment and different occurrences which happens in them.

2. Human geography is the study of the relationship between human activities and the impact on the earth. It also studied how the earth’s processes have varying impacts on humans.

<h3>What is bedding in sedimentary rocks?</h3>

Bedding is a major feature of sedimentary rocks, that are often composed of strata of sedimentary layers formed one on top of another. Layers of sediments with varying particle sizes are accumulated on top of one another in sedimentary rocks bedding.

Bedding can occur when one distinctively dissimilar layer of sediment is deposited on top of a previous layer or when sedimentary rock is formed with a fresh layer of sediments.
